TRANSPORTATION


Kaufman’s location between Interstates 20 and 45 provides a strategic location for business seeking access to major markets with controlled operating costs. Kaufman provides both east-west and north-south highway connectivity without the traffic constraints of cities within the urban core of the Dallas-Fort Worth area. Businesses locating in Kaufman can reach a customer base of over 55 million people within a 500 mile radius. Our location also affords access to two Union Pacific Rail Terminals within 30 minutes, providing rail access to markets on the west coast and in the midwest. Kaufman is also less than 4 hours from the Port of Houston, one of the largest ports in the nation. The Caddo-Bossier River Port near Shreveport, Louisiana is approximately 2 ½ hours from Kaufman, providing closer port access with river cargo capability and connection to the Gulf. The International Inland Port of Dallas sits within 30 minutes of Kaufman, one of the largest industrial logistics hubs in nation providing significant benefits for the regional supply chain.
Kaufman is within one hour of two major commercial airports. Dallas-Fort Worth International Airport is one of the largest airports in the world with nonstop flights to approximately 270 destinations worldwide. It is also the home of American Airlines and is one of the busiest cargo airports in the nation. Dallas Love Field Airport serves approximately 77 nonstop domestic destinations and is the home of Southwest Airlines and private jet activity.
The Terrell Municipal Airport is located approximately 15 minutes north of Kaufman and features a 5,006’ runway for general aviation traffic. The Mesquite Metro Airport is located approximately 30 minutes from Kaufman and provides a 6,000’ runway for general aviation and private jet aircraft.
Kaufman is part of the STAR Transit network, offering curb-to-curb transit services allowing easy access to the places you need to be. STAR’s transit network covers communities throughout Kaufman, Rockwall and southeast Dallas Counties. Costs are between $1-$2 for every five miles you travel, or you can get single ride, day, or monthly passes for an added discount. STAR also partners with businesses and organizations needing consistent transportation options for employees.
